parsing RSDP & MADT

+#include <rsdp.h>
+#include <heap.h>
+#include <paging.h>
+#include <libk/string.h>
+#include <libk/stdio.h>
+
+uint64_t* find_rsdp()
+{
+ map_addr(0x0, 0x0, FLAG_PRESENT);
+ const char* rsdp_cs = "RSD PTR ";
+ for (uint64_t i = 0x10; i < 0x100000; i += 0x10) {
+ char *x = (char*)i;
+ uint8_t ind = 1;
+ for (size_t j = 0; j < strlen(rsdp_cs); j++) {
+ if (rsdp_cs[j] != x[j]) {
+ ind = 0;
+ break;
+ }
+ }
+ if (ind) {
+ return (uint64_t*)i;
+ }
+ }
+ return NULL;
+}
+
+uint64_t* find_sys_table_addr(const char* signature)
+{
+ uint64_t* rsdp = find_rsdp();
+
+ if (rsdp == NULL) {
+ printf("RSDP NOT FOUND\n");
+ return NULL;
+ }
+
+ struct RSDP_descriptor* rsdp_desc = (struct RSDP_descriptor*)rsdp;
+ map_addr(rsdp_desc->RsdtAddress, rsdp_desc->RsdtAddress, FLAG_PRESENT);
+
+ struct ACPI_header* rsdt = (struct ACPI_header*)kalloc(sizeof(struct ACPI_header));
+ memcpy(rsdt, (uint64_t*)(uint64_t)rsdp_desc->RsdtAddress, sizeof(struct ACPI_header));
+
+ uint32_t entries = (rsdt->Length - (uint32_t)sizeof(struct ACPI_header)) / 4;
+
+ for (size_t i = 0; i < entries; i++) {
+ uint32_t na_addr = (uint32_t)rsdp_desc->RsdtAddress + (uint32_t)sizeof(struct ACPI_header) + (uint32_t)i * 4;
+ uint32_t addr;
+ memcpy(&addr, (uint64_t*)(uint64_t)na_addr, 4);
+
+ struct ACPI_header* t = (struct ACPI_header*)kalloc(sizeof(struct ACPI_header));
+ memcpy(t, (uint64_t*)(uint64_t)addr, sizeof(struct ACPI_header));
+
+ int ind = 1;
+ for (size_t j = 0; j < 4; j++) {
+ if (t->Signature[j] != signature[j])
+ ind = 0;
+ }
+ if (ind) {
+ kfree(t);
+ kfree(rsdt);
+ return (uint64_t*)(uint64_t)addr;
+ }
+
+ kfree(t);
+ }
+
+ kfree(rsdt);
+ return NULL;
+}
